Two ME teams won Awards at the 11th Engineering InnoShow, HKU

Organized by the Innovation Academy, the Engineering InnoShow is held at the end of each semester, offering students a platform to showcase innovative projects and achievements to peers and the public, fostering knowledge exchange and societal impact.

The 11th Engineering InnoShow, themed “Together, We Innovate!”, took place at the Tam Wing Fan Innovation Wing on April 29, 2026. Engineering students demonstrated their projects to a panel of judges during the event.

Five teams were selected as winners of the InnoShow Award, while one team received the “Super Good Job Project Award.” The InnoShow Award, judged by a professional panel, aims to encourage students to cultivate innovative approaches to engineering and social challenges while supporting outstanding ideas for international design competitions. The Dean’s Innovation and Entrepreneurship Fund will allocate HK$100,000 to sponsor up to five participating student teams from the InnoShow for international competitions. The “Super Good Job Project Award” was determined by participant voting.

Two of the winning teams are from the Department of Mechanical Engineering, which are,

(1) HKU ROV Team – winner of InnoShow Award and Super Good Job Project Award

(2) Overhead Power Line Coating Robot Development – winner of InnoShow Award

HKU ROV team

The team successfully designed an underwater robot for handling a diverse range of underwater tasks, including AI invasion species detection and gripping underwater objects with claws. The team members demonstrated their dedication in engineering work, and advanced engineering knowledge in mechanical design, and programming knowledge through their underwater robot designed.

Their robot stood out with its innovative, modular underwater robot frame design, and a cutting-edge AI invasion species detection system. The team was ultimately awarded the Innoshow Award and the Super Good Job Project Award for their underwater robot project for their dedicated effort.

Overhead Power Line Coating Robot Development

Overhead Power Line Coating Robot Development was developed as a final year project under the supervision of Dr. Match Ko, Assistant Head in the Department of Mechanical Engineering.  This project aims to create a robot that allows for easy removal and replacement of insulation, reduction of labor time, and elimination of the need for power outages during maintenance.

In the end, a functional prototype of the robot was developed and tested on simulated rigs and realistic training setups to evaluate the functionality of the robot. Results showed the robot’s performance is comparable to existing solutions in key aspects, successfully ascending and operating on live cables to install sleeves with acceptable reliability. While some parts could subject to future improvements, this prototype showed potential to lower labor costs, increase cable insulative installation speed, and offer a non-permanent insulation alternative.
